Ok giving my 1 day post op LASIK review.

Ok giving my 1 day post op LASIK review.

Short Version: It's like a whole new world. I was never been able to see as well as I do now. I have no pain and the procedure itself was painless. For anyone on the fence about this procedure you should be thinking, "shut up and take my money." It's that awesome 10/10 but google only lets me give 5 stars.

Long Version:
I have used glasses since I was in 4th grade. My last pair was the highest end safety prescription glasses I could find. I scratched them and needed either new glasses or another option. Dr. Leavitt and his staff were amazing. They explained the procedure, risks (far less than wearing contacts), and any possible complications. I also watched the YouTube video showing the actual procedure in real time so I knew exactly what I was getting into (don't do this if you're squeamish).

Procedure Day: I picked up my eye drops from the pharmacy and headed upstairs. The staff went over the procedure and gave me the anti anxiety medication. Dr. Leavitt explained exactly what was going to happen and what I would feel before going in to the OR.

In the OR: The OR is dimly lit with a soft bed that you lay on. There are two steps to the procedure. Cut the flap and shape the cornea.

Cutting the flap: Dr. Leavitt numbs your eye with eye drops and places a reference mark with a fancy medical pen on both eyes. You don't feel it at all. You also don't have a feeling that you need to blink. You then get a suction cup device placed over the eye. Once again you feel nothing but a little pressure.
You are then placed under the machine and are looking at a ring of white LED lights. The machine presses on the suction cup and you see nothing out of that eye except a dull white light. The machine makes no noise and just when you think "when is it going to cut the flap?" it's done. Ie: no pain or anything odd, it's done. This is repeated for the other eye.

Lazing the Cornea:
Dr. Leavitt rotates the table over the the Lazing machine. He puts a lid holder on the eye being corrected and removes the flap. I was most freaked about this part before the surgery but needn't have been. Once again YOU FEEL NOTHING. You also don't see the flap being moved just a little bit of blurriness. After the flap is removed you get lazed.

Laser Part: The laser machine has an orange blinking dot. You look right at the center of the dot. When the machine starts, a fan makes a snapping noise, and you will see light blue flashes that are really dim as well as the blinking led that you are staring at. In my case each eye took about 30 seconds. You will smell a slight burning smell. Just think: "burning smell is bad vision leaving my eyes."

After the laser is done Dr. Leavitt places the flap back into position and smooths it with a sponge. Once again I was somewhat freaked out about this before the surgery but, YOU FEEL NOTHING and you don't see the actual sponging. After this is done in both eyes you will be instructed to keep your eyes closed or blink rapidly when walking to the car.

My vision was a little blurry immediately after the procedure but better then without glasses before surgery. After a few hours my vision was better than with glasses. The morning after the procedure my vision is mind blowing. Colors are super vivid and crisp. Really there is no way to describe how much better the world looks. It is truly life changing.

The only odd thing which is normal is that I can see a small fuzzy halo around bright LED lights. Dr. Leavitt has assured me that this will subside over time. Even if it didn't the procedure is so worth it. Dr. Leavitt also told me that as good as my vision is right now it will become even more stunning as the eye heals.

Note of Caution: The tape that they give you to hold you eye shields on sticks really well, especially to hair. Taking the tape off in the morning was the only pain/discomfort that I experienced throughout the entire process. Be careful and don't tape your hair before sleeping :)
